My Paf Prog .... is up the creek without a paddle.... I discovered earlier that -- somehow it had at least 4 of each person under different RIN's  how that happened I dont know.

I was going to attempt to sort it.. But it didnt seem to be a problem when printing out a specific report, so didnt really bother.  Do intend to update to a new Database when I have found the right one this year anyway.


BUT I just opened it up first time in a week or so.. and... It has decided to show me the different parents and different marriages... crazy.  will add snip.

Can you not use the match/merge tool, then it will link both numbers and become just the one person.
